by December, he was a lame duck and had nothing to do with it any longer. It was between Paulson and the incoming administration. As Frank says, all the Obama administration had to do was pick up the phone and call Paulson. The White House refused to do so.

This is right in line with other things they were doing at the time which were so frustrating to those of use trying to get real, smart action on the economic front. It wasn't the first or the last time the WH refused to pursue cramdowns, for example. Also, don't forget that they had promised during the campaign that they would demand more from the banks before doling out TARP II funds, but those promises never amounted to anything. Obama had so much leverage and never used it. As a result, we let the banks loot the national treasure while they were held completely unaccountable and the American people were hung out to dry.
